Optic Choices (Red Dot vs. Holographic vs. LPVO) 

Optics are going to be the primary way we aim our rifles, so choose wisely. We have some things to figure out if we want to fight in the dark. Red dots are standard nowadays, and they’re usually the easiest to learn with and use night or day. Red dots come in two distinct offerings: diode or holographic. 

Scalarworks leap mounts for vortex razor and aimpoint t1 night vision height mounts

Above: Scalar-works LEAP 1.93 mounts for the Vortex Gen 2 Razor 1-6 (Left) and Aimpoint T-1 (Right).

Diode-based optics project light from an LED, which the front lens reflects it back toward your eye. Very simple and robust. The downside is that this projected light can appear distorted for those of us with imperfect vision (especially astigmatism). If that’s not an issue, then the hard part comes in with choosing a specific optic. This is one of the more personal choices that you’ll have to make. I use the Aimpoint Micro series most of the time, unless I’m testing something for another company, because they have a long battery life, low weight, small size, and a sturdy housing with easy adjustments. No frills, they just work. If you plan to use night vision, make sure to get a model that features low-brightness settings designed for this purpose.

Battle Arms Development Aimpoint T-1 Unity Tactical Fast Mount

Above: Battle Arms Development Workhorse with an Aimpoint T-1 on a Unity Tactical Fast mount.

Another option you have is a holographic sight like one of the EOTech models or the Vortex UH-1. These have much shorter battery life than red dots, but work well with magnifiers and night vision. Depending on your eyes, you may see a sparkly reticle or a solid one. I’ve been told by a significant amount of people that their astigmatism is lessened by holographic sights, as well. When it comes to holographic sights, I’ve been gravitating toward the Vortex UH-1 Gen 2, but that is once again a personal choice. You must make your own.

Vortex Razor Gen 3 low light rifle setup

Above: The Vortex Razor Gen 3 1-10 in a Geissele 1.5 height mount with a Holosun 508T on a Reptilia Corp ROF-90 mount.

The third option for optic selection is a Low Power Variable Optic (LPVO), typically with magnification range around 1-6x. LPVOs have an advantage over the other two types of optic: an etched reticle. Depending on the brand and optic you choose, there are some awesome choices out there from Vortex, Leupold, and Nightforce. These optics have magnification when you want it, and models with an illuminated reticle can be used like a red dot with practice. The main downsides are that they’re significantly heavier and more expensive than red dots. Illuminated LPVOs have similar battery life to a holographic sight. When it comes to LPVOs, you’re now working with a more precise optic that you can use to dive deeper into the pool of precision. 

Mount Height 

With optic selection comes mount selection. Mounts typically range from 1.3 inches all the way to 2.33. So, let’s go through them to see what may fit your needs.

t-1 micro mount heights

Above: From left to right, an ADM 1/3 co-witness mount, Scalar-works LEAP 1.93, and Unity Tactical Fast 2.26.

1.3 to 1.5 are great for magnified scopes, or for when you need a consistent cheekweld for precision shooting. Just be aware some scopes won’t fit in a 1.3 depending on the objective lens size. I also don’t recommend the 1.3 and 1.5 (absolute co-witness) for red dots on most weapons. It’s unnecessarily low for the needs that a red dot fits, but like everything, it’s your choice.

The next step up is a 1.7, also known as a 1/3 (or “lower third”) co-witness height. This is a popular place to mount LVPOs and red dots for iron sight co-witness, if you still use iron sights. It’s still a little low for those of you trying to use it for night vision, and depending on head size, you may end up craning your neck.

Unity Tactical Fast Mount T-1 Micro night vision rifle setup night vision optics

1.93 is the next height — this is at the limits of comfort for any prone shooting with night vision, but it’s a great height for those who plan to be upright or standing more than prone. I enjoy the 1.93 or 2.05 for my LPVOs that I’ll be using as a primary optic. This height also works well for red dots.

Next up are the 2.26 and 2.33 heights. I don’t suggest these for an LPVO. It ends up being difficult to consistently avoid parallax — not that it cannot be trained, but it’ll take more work and is very straining on the neck for anything prone. My suggestion for any mount that you choose is to figure out the purpose of the rifle and the optic you’re using to make a choice. 

two carbines night vision optics low-light no-light carbine setups

Above Top: Battle Arms Development Workhorse — my main jam. Below: Rosco MFG 12.5 URG — my do-it-all rifle.

Another style of mount selection is blending the traditional mounts above with an offset mount. There are a lot of combination mounts that you can put micro red dots on the top or side (45-degree) of your scope. This adds a level of redundancy and options to enhance your capabilities. Top-mounted red dots on scopes are one of my favorite styles, as it gives me ambidextrous use of my rifle in a scope or red dot capacity. I still enjoy using side-mounted dots when I use a higher magnified optic or am trying to keep the height profile of my rifle down. Either one needs some personal consideration depending on your setup and needs.

Weapon-Mounted Lights (White vs. IR) 

Weapon-mounted lights are an absolute must for a rifle. The only exception is something used exclusively for daytime competitions. As for a dedicated low-light rifle, you’ll need a good light. By good light, I’m not just talking about any light that says “tactical” and comes with a rail mount. I’m talking about the output on multiple levels. Your light should have high candela, lumen, and lux stats. Candela is the intensity of the beam emitted from the light. Lumens is the overall brightness rating of the light. Lux is the intensity of the light in a given area or distance. Personally, I stick to two companies that I believe have surpassed the others in performance capability. Modlite and Cloud Defensive have made lights that are modular and offer outstanding performance in these key areas. Modlite offers lights that are compatible with industry-standard mounts, tailcaps, switches, and other components. Cloud has attacked the market in another way, starting from the ground up to develop two different-style lights, the OWL and REIN. Both companies make great products that someone can adapt to their needs. 

weapon mounted lights cloud defensive rain, modlite okw, surefire m600v

Above: From left to right, the Cloud Defensive REIN, Modlite OKW, and SureFire M600V.

If you’re operating under night vision, you may want either a dedicated infrared (IR) or dual-output white/IR light. These are very specific use items. Depending on your laser setup, you can supplement it with a dual spectrum light like the SureFire M300V/M600V “Vampire” series. Just remember most dual-spectrum lights provide both IR and white light, but usually do both jobs sub-optimally. Most use these lights to add more IR illumination to the area they’re targeting for passive night vision use, or as a searching tool. The only dual-spectrum light I use is on my helmet. Muzzle Devices (Muzzle Brakes, Flash Hiders, and Suppressors)

Muzzle devices vary in many ways, and each will have pros and cons. The most common muzzle devices are muzzle brakes and flash hiders. Beyond those, there are also suppressors, which are my favorite option. I can be seen in the wild most of the time using one. Let’s get into some of the details.

Surefire Warcomp, Dead Air KeyMo, Surefire Warcome closed Tine muzzle devices for low light carbineAbove: From top to bottom, a SureFire Warcomp flash hider, Dead Air Keymount brake, SureFire Warcomp closed-tine flash hider. 

Muzzle brakes, also known as compensators, are usually the best at recoil mitigation because of the way they redirect gases to force the muzzle lower or reduce muzzle climb. That benefit also has some downsides. I’ve found that if I shoot with a brake/compensator for long enough, I start to relax my shooting position. I relax so much to the point that shooting with anything else is harder to manage. Also, if you’re shooting next to others — teammates and/or classmates — you’ll be hated by all. That redirection of gases and concussive force is very harsh to your neighbors. I suggest that you don’t shoot a muzzle brake indoors, since it’ll be unpleasant even with the best ear protection.

night vision carbine muzzle setup

Above: Battle Arms Development Rail with a Rosco MFG Bloodline barrel, SureFire RC2, and Rail­-scales EXO panels.

Flash hiders conceal the muzzle flash by using slots or holes in the muzzle device. Flash hiders are also misinterpreted: They don’t hide all the muzzle flash; they mitigate or minimize it. Flash hiders were originally meant to help the shooter’s eyesight by not overwhelming the photo receptors in their eyes. Some flash hiders also help with recoil, giving you a blend of a brake and hider. Just remember, most devices that do both usually aren’t ideal at either one. 

SureFire RC2, Dead Air Sandman S, and OSS 556K

Above: Left to right is a SureFire RC2, Dead Air Sandman S, and OSS 556K.

Both kinds of muzzle devices can also include a mount for a suppressor. Suppressors, also known as silencers, use a series of baffles or chambers to limit the expansion of gases. This limits the noise coming from the rifle and can also potentially limit the amount of flash, depending on the length of rifle and suppressor. Suppressors add weight to the front of the rifle, and that takes some getting used to if you don’t do enough pushups. For some, a suppressor is cost-prohibitive, but I highly recommend you save your pennies for one. Suppressors are the ultimate muzzle device for a low-light rifle and can also help protect your hearing. The only other downside is that they get extremely hot with use, so don’t burn yourself.

Laser Devices

Laser devices come in a lot of shapes and sizes. Lasers are also very specific tools and must be cared for, so they take a dedicated user. They’re not plug-and-play like some believe them to be. They must be carefully positioned and zeroed, much like an optic. I don’t recommend just grabbing any laser off the internet. Choose the laser that’ll fit your needs. Visible lasers are great for certain uses, like gas mask work and practicing for IR laser use. Be aware that they have limitations due to lighting in the environment you’re working in. IR laser devices are meant for use under night vision, so they won’t be visible to the naked eye. As a result, IR lasers are often paired with a visible laser, so that if one is zeroed you know the other should be, too. Since I use a lot of night vision and teach it, I use a B.E. Meyers MAWL, which has a visible laser, IR laser, and an IR illuminator. I suggest those going into night vision get something with all three tools.

VirTra Training: Total Immersion Gun Simulation

Summer 2020 in Arizona wasn’t conducive to live-fire training, given the perfect storm of 115-degree temperatures, wildfire-related shooting restrictions on public land, COVID-induced range closures, and extremely high ammo prices. Rather than rely solely on dry-fire practice at home, I decided this was the ideal time to try out the state-of-the-art VirTra firearms simulator at the Haley Strategic headquarters in Scottsdale, Arizona. Haley’s D7 Disruptive Performance course is a two-day program that’s limited to just five students, and it takes place without a single live round fired. I attended a D7 Carbine class, but Handgun and Handgun Lowlight versions are also available.

The VirTra system is no oversized arcade game — it’s a sophisticated simulator with an impressive degree of realism. Students use real BCM AR-15s retrofitted with VirTra internals that produce CO2-powered recoil and a laser flash with each trigger press. An array of sensors detect where the laser impacts on a projector screen, a computer calculates ballistic trajectory in the virtual environment, and the shooter receives real-time audio and visual feedback.

The D7 Carbine course began with a classroom portion that introduced Haley’s “thinkers before shooters” ethos, thoroughly analyzing the mental and physical aspects involved in firearms training. After discussing zeros and hold-overs for various distances, we stepped up to the VirTra 100 single-screen simulator, firing our ARs from a prone position at virtual targets from 50 to 500 yards. Our instructors, Josh and Robert, were able to instantly enlarge our targets and provide guidance based on our shot groups.

virtra carbine

Next was a detailed discussion of shooting fundamentals, such as stance, trigger control, sight picture, and eye movement — the latter becomes especially important when dealing with multiple targets in a dynamic setting. Back on the single-screen sim, we ran various drills from low ready and high ready, maintaining an even cadence between shots and receiving one-on-one evaluation from instructors. We finished our first day in the flagship VirTra 300 simulator, testing our ability to pivot and transition between simulated clay targets across the 300-degree screen. On day two, we warmed up with the same transition drill, then returned to the single-screen sim for box drills that tested our footwork and ability to move forward, backward, and laterally between shots. The final classroom portion of the D7 class was taught by Travis Haley. It covered the powerful effects of a life-and-death scenario, such as the body alarm response (BAR) that dumps hormones such as adrenaline and cortisol into the bloodstream. Rather than attempt to resist this inevitable process, we must learn to anticipate and manage it.

Since firsthand experience is a powerful teacher, the D7 class culminated by testing each student’s performance inside the panoramic simulator. One by one, students were called into the darkroom and fitted with a belt-mounted Threat-Fire pack, which delivered a 10,000-volt shock any time we were hit by a virtual incoming round. The consequences of failure would be painful, and this elevated the sense of tension. Haley’s VirTra system includes dozens of scenarios, and each features branching paths and outcomes that can be controlled by the instructor in real-time. This made it feel like interacting with live opponents, rather than pre-programmed AI.

We experienced two scenarios, a mugging at an outdoor ATM and an active shooter situation inside a courthouse. These scenarios included multiple assailants, innocent bystanders, and ally first responders, as well as complications such as armored foes and hostage-takers — in the latter case, I was able to negotiate a surrender after an agonizing 90-second standoff. However, I didn’t walk away unscathed from the ATM mugging. Seconds after stopping the first threat, I was blindsided by an accomplice I had failed to notice. I returned fire, but got zapped and received a wake-up call about the dangers of tunnel vision.

This Haley Strategic D7 Carbine class was an incredible experience, and a powerful reminder that real defensive scenarios are far more complex than drills on a 180-degree shooting range.

Saiti explained that he breaks down shooting skills into six manageable chunks, which must be mastered individually and then layered. The first subject of the day was stance. Feet should be shoulder-width apart, hips square to the target, and knees and elbows slightly bent to absorb recoil. Saiti recommended shifting more weight onto the balls of my feet until I almost toppled forward. I felt my toes digging into the ground and shin muscles tightening — this greatly improved my stability.

The second topic of the clinic was grip. Some instructors recommend 60/40 or 70/30 pressure from your support and dominant hands; Saiti recommends 100/100. Grip the gun as tightly as possible with both hands, as long as trigger finger dexterity isn’t diminished. Choke up high on the grip, make sure there are no voids between the hands and the gun, and push the support thumb forward on the frame.

nick saiti secret weapon training instruction

Third, Saiti discussed draw technique. Both hands should be moved in unison to the level of the holster; this symmetrical movement prevents favoring one side. Establish a consistent, strong grip, and bring hands together in the workspace where you’d naturally clap your hands. Keep the barrel flat as you drive the gun up and out to eye level, fast at first, then slower to acquire a sight picture. To test your draw, start with a good stance, close your eyes, draw normally, and open your eyes. If your mechanics are perfect, you should see a clear sight picture every time. Saiti says, “Technique will take you most of the way. Your eyes just confirm it.”

These three topics are the most fundamental layers — if you can nail them, you’re off to a great start. Reloading was the fourth topic. Focus on getting the mag up to the gun and aligned quickly, then guide it in and re-establish grip. Too many students try to save time by slamming the magazine in quickly; this is only a tiny fraction of the reload time. Topics five and six, efficient transitions and movement, offered more “meat on the bone” to shave time that can be spent taking shots.

Saiti closed the Competition Pistol Clinic with an analogy. If you spill nails on the floor, what’s the fastest way to clean them up? You could go get a vacuum, rig up a magnet on a string, or Google a solution, but the real answer is to simply bend down and pick them up immediately. Learning to become a Grand Master is much the same — it’s a matter of time and hard work. PTSD

Somewhere between 3 to 8 percent of the population will deal with Post Traumatic Stress Disorder, or PTSD, in their lifetime. In the past 30 years, progress has been made in identifying therapies to aid in the recovery of individuals afflicted by PTSD. Several treatment modalities have shown benefit. The purpose of this article is to review some of those treatment modalities. We hear more about PTSD today due in part to its fairly recent recognition by several organizations as a “real” psychiatric disorder as well as increased public service announcements. 

A lengthy and specific definition of PTSD can be found in the Diagnostic and Statistical Manual of Mental Disorders, Fifth Edition (DSM-5). To summarize, people who have PTSD are often those who have undergone a traumatic experience related to near death or perhaps a trauma related to sexual abuse. They often have flashbacks, distressing dreams, or memories of the traumatic event. Because of these symptoms, patients may avoid anything that reminds them of the event. 

These experiences cause a variety of symptoms, including anxiety, irritability, disruptive behavior, depression, isolation, and even suicidal thoughts. We now have a common screening assessment for PTSD, called the PTSD Checklist (PCL). There’s a version for civilians (PCL-C) and one for military (PCL-M). If you score above 44 on the PCL-C, or 50 on the PCL-M, you may have PTSD, and need to see a doctor for further recommendations. A shorter version is the PCL-6, where a score of 14 or greater suggests that PTSD is likely.

ptsd chart

A physician may prescribe medication, psychotherapy, or both to assist in treatment. Studies have shown that these are about 50-percent effective in helping those with symptoms of PTSD — not perfect, but every bit helps. Medication stabilizes the mood and lessens some of the symptoms that are disrupting the individual’s life. Therapy is an essential adjunct to help the person overcome the negative associations and psychological pain attributed to the event. 

Medication

Drugs like Selective Seratonin Reuptake Inhibitors (SSRIs) and Seratonin-Norepinephrine Reuptake Inhibitors (SNRIs) are the standard of care for PTSD. SSRIs include drugs like Sertraline (Zoloft), Fluoxetine (Prozac), and Paroxitine (Paxil); Venlefaxine (Effexor) is a recommended SNRI. These drugs work on chemical components of the brain that help the patient deal with anxiety and depression that’s often experienced with PTSD. 

Another drug that has been helpful in some patients with PTSD is Prazosin. This drug is commonly used to treat enlarged prostate in men; however, it has been shown in some people to reduce the number of nightmares and improve quality of sleep. Study conclusions have been mixed as to Prazosin’s general effectiveness; however, it’s typically recommended to see if there’s a benefit in each individual patient. 

Lastly, medical marijuana has gained a lot of popularity for treating just about everything under the sun; however, it hasn’t been shown to provide a benefit in PTSD patients. 

Mindfulness

Jon Kabat-Zinn wrote his treatise on mindfulness back in 1990, detailing what mindfulness is and how to go about being mindful. In short, he proposed that we become mindful of the moment. Savor the food we chew. Feel the sun on our face and the grass beneath our feet. In doing so, we can gain an appreciation of our current moment and live a better, more in touch, life. 

Often with PTSD, the trauma keeps rearing its ugly head, and we forget about the moment we are living, and step back into a horrible time in our lives. Mindfulness offers an escape from the past as we focus on the now. There’s an excellent app called Mindfulness Coach that I recommend. Also check out www.mindful.org to learn more about mindfulness.

stock praying

Above: Mindfulness and meditation are essential components of PTSD treatment.  

EMDR

Eye Movement Desensitization and Reprocessing (EMDR) was developed by Dr. Francine Shapiro in 1990. It’s a complex form of therapy that combines modalities from other therapies to have its beneficial effects. Basically, in EMDR, the traumatic event is recalled while a repetitive act is performed (tapping fingers, roving eyes). This interrupts the old thoughts associated with the memory and creates a new pathway for the brain to associate with the event. The process can take a while to prime the patient for successful treatment. It has a lot of research showing its benefit, as supported by the World Health Organization, the American Psychiatric Association, and the Veterans Administration. I have seen this work in several patients with amazing success. See www.emdr.com for more information.

stock nurse or doctor

Above: Physicians should take a multi-disciplinary approach to treat PTSD.

Stellate Ganglion Block

The idea of using medication injected into the stellate ganglion on the right side of the neck was first proposed in the 1940s. It wasn’t until 2010 that the first study was done to see if stellate ganglion block could help with PTSD. Although the exact mechanism of how it works is unknown, the idea is that it “calms down” sympathetic stimulation of the nerves during anxious times. It’s still being used, but there’s mixed evidence that it’s helpful. The Veterans Administration suggests that more study needs to be done on this modality. 

Cognitive Behavioral Therapy

This popular and effective therapy focuses on the symptoms of trauma and its effects on thoughts, feelings, and behaviors. There are two modalities commonly used in CBT: exposure therapy and cognitive restructuring. In exposure therapy, the person might be asked to relive the trauma in a safe environment. The exposure can be written, verbal, or even virtual reality-based. In cognitive restructuring, the person is asked to recall the trauma in a more logical way, as they often only remember pieces of the trauma and sew together what they may have missed. The goal is to have the patient re-evaluate their negative associations with the trauma and to develop more effective patterns of thought. There are typically 12 to 16 sessions involved. 

cognitive behavioral therapy

Above: Cognitive Behavioral Therapy has been proven to be effective in treating PTSD.

Cognitive Processing Therapy

This was developed in the 1980s and is a specific subset of Cognitive Behavioral Therapy aimed at treating those who have succumbed to a sexually traumatic experience. Often, patients blame themselves after such an incident. Patients are asked to think about their trauma and how it has affected them. In order to overcome their trauma, they must develop an understanding of how they feel in relation to the trauma. They must develop new patterns of behavior associated with the event (e.g. “I survived the trauma because I fought the SOB,” rather than “How did I let this happen?”). CPT is typically 12 sessions long. 

Post-Traumatic Stress Disorder affects millions of people in the U.S. Our understanding of screening, diagnosis, and treatment has improved over the past 30 years. PTSD is now recognized by the American Psychiatric Association and the World Health Organization as a disease. Medications and relatively newer therapies, such as Eye Movement Desensitization and Reprocessing, as well as older therapies, such as Cognitive Behavioral Therapies, can provide benefits to people afflicted with PTSD. Treatment is lifelong, and there are no shortcuts. There is help, and there is hope, for those suffering with PTSD.

NODs and Night Vision Tubes: Evaluating what Counts

Throughout human history, our species has always looked for advantages in both technology and tactics. The rock became the club, which became the spear, which became the arrow, and finally the firearm. The sword was always more important than the shield, and offensive technology was always forward-thinking and progressive. Regardless of time, culture, race, or creed, humans have always looked at our resources and thought, how can we weaponize this? One of the biggest hindrances to warfare has always been darkness — sure, fighting happened at night, but up until recently, it wasn’t conducted the way we do business in this century. And today, what is more evocative of a “Tip-of-the-Spear Operator” than a NODs wearing warfighter. 

Enter image intensification, more commonly known as night vision (NV). It’s light amplification on a large scale, turning very small amounts of light photons (be they visible or infrared) into multiplied electrons, then back to photons in a wavelength that our feeble human eyes can see. Green or White?

One of the most readily apparent factors of NV is phosphor screen color. A much-debated topic as of the last several years, emotions can and do run deep surrounding this subject. To understand the argument, we must first understand how the human eye works.

The retinas of our eyes have two types of photoreceptors: rods for night and cones for day. Rods are sensitive enough to perceive trace amounts of light, such as silhouettes on a moonlit night, but cannot detect color and offer low visual acuity (sharpness). Cones are far less sensitive to light, but can interpret millions of colors with much greater detail. There are three kinds of cones: red, green, and blue sensitive. Cones also give you spatial acuity, which is why you’re much less likely to stumble or stub your toe in broad daylight than you would be in a dark room. The rod and cone cells are distributed evenly throughout the retina, except in a small central area called the fovea, where there are only cone cells. The fovea is the part used for detailed vision, like reading. This is why your peripheral vision feels less precise than your direct gaze.

It takes about a thousand times more light to activate the color cone cells than it does the monochrome rods, which is why detail and depth perception are much better when using both cones and rods, instead of just rods. Rods don’t provide much detail. The goal of NODs is to take light that might only be detectable to your rods, and intensify the image enough to allow your cone cells to detect it clearly.

NODs night vision

When using green phosphor (GP) NV we use our green cone cells, which make up only about one-third of our day vision. Humans generally don’t use rod cells with green phosphor NV systems or NODs.

With white phosphor (WP) NV (white light being the sum of all colors) we engage all three types of our day vision cones. So, WP is fully engaging our day vision mechanisms (cones) and even some of our NV mechanisms (rods). WP also has a strong blue component in the 400-nanometer wavelength range, where we engage a more substantial portion of our rod cells.

Using a WP NODs is akin to being able to use more of your brain processing power to think through and solve problems. You can certainly accomplish similar tasks with GP, but you’ll probably do so faster with WP due to the physiology involved. It delivers more light data to your brain. This leads to reduced fatigue because you’re not working as hard to gather the same amount of information. Contrast is higher and the data feed is broader.

You might be about to retort, “But Sam, the human eye can detect more shades of green than any other color in the visible spectrum!” Yeah, I’ve heard that a time or two. Here’s what you need to know about that — the dark-adapted human eye is capable of detecting more shades of green than any other color. What happens when you power up a bright phosphor screen in front of your eye? Bingo, no longer dark-adapted, so that factoid goes right out the window. In scientific terms, there’s a chemical compound in your eye called rhodopsin that’s produced at night. Once exposed to bright light, it photo bleaches.

operators wearing nods

Colorblindness is generally a genetic mutation of one of (or a combination of) the red, green, or blue cone photoreceptor cells in your eyes. True color blindness genes are carried on the X-chromosome, which is why it’s spread from grandfather to grandson. Very rarely is it expressed in women. If you’re truly colorblind, then that can affect your choice a bit, but WP probably still comes out on top for the reasons I outlined above. If you can’t see green, then WP is even more clearly the choice. If you can’t see red and blue, then maybe GP is the better choice for you.

That said, much of this argument still comes down to personal preference for many people. Nothing compares to trying both GP and WP in-person over an extended period of time to literally see which phosphor color one prefers. The physio/neurological basis for the detail, contrast, and fatigue advantages of WP are true regardless, but remember this as well: Some people are born with more of one type of photoreceptors than other folks. The same can be said about rods, as some people’s natural unaided NV is better than others, so genetics can come into play a little. Finally, individual tube and NODs specs and NV generation are important variables to consider. As we’ll explain momentarily, these issues need to be taken into account independently of phosphor choice for a truly useful comparison of WP versus GP. 

Next, we must get into the nitty-gritty of the tubes’ actual performance. Think of tube specs as what a dyno readout says about an engine’s horsepower and torque. In my opinion, the following are the five most important tube data points. It should be noted that there are others, such as luminance gain and high light resolution, that aren’t included due to their secondary nature as NV tube spec data points. This is a reference for U.S. Gen 3 systems and data sheets.

wearing nods at night

Photocathode Sensitivity: Photocathode Sensitivity is the PC’s ability to convert Photons to electrons. A higher PR usually corresponds to good SNR numbers. The minimum is 1,800 for the OMNI 8 contract. 1,800 is good, anything above 2,000 is very good. It matters a great deal to have properly matched photocathode numbers for a dual-tube system, +/- 100 is generally the range I adhere to when building/assembling dual-tube systems. This will prevent one tube from appearing noticeably brighter than another while in operation.

EBI or Equivalent Background Illumination: This is the amount of light you see through NODs when an image tube is turned on, but no light is on the photocathode. EBI is affected by temperature; the warmer the NV device, the brighter the background illumination. EBI is measured in lumens per square centimeter (lm/cm2). The lower the value the better. The EBI level determines the lowest light level at which an image can be detected. Below this light level, objects will be masked by the EBI. The lower the better. For example, this will determine the contrast of a ridgeline against the sky behind it. EBI is an often-overlooked data point, but is a very important one — many times the most important in terms of detecting and/or differentiating objects.

SNR or Signal to Noise Ratio: Plays a key role in NV performance. The role of the micro-channel plate, SNR is the unit’s ability to transfer a strong signal from input to output and is usually referenced as a ratio (19:1, for example). This measures the light signal reaching the eye divided by the perceived noise as seen by the eye. The higher the difference between the two numbers, the better. As the light level drops, scintillation (visual noise or graininess) will be noted sooner on a tube with lower SNR versus one with higher SNR.

nods close up

Center Resolution: Screen resolution measured in line pairs per millimeter (LP/mm). The higher the better. Usually listed in line pair increments of 57, 64, 72, 81, and so on. When a center resolution is listed, the line pair measurement could in fact be higher, but not high enough to cross the threshold of the next listed LP resolution. For example, a 64-line pair listed tube could in fact be as high as 71-line pairs, but because it doesn’t meet or exceed the 72 limit it cannot be listed as such.

Line pair resolution is generally not as important as many people make it out to be. For example, the human eye cannot tell the difference between a 64- and a 72-line pair when viewed through a 1x system such as a PVS-14. However, when used or viewed in clip-on NODs alongside a magnified rifle optic, a higher center resolution is preferred and often noticeable for better resolution/image quality.

Halo: Bloom or halo when looking at light source, or the ability to control the bloom when viewed. The lower the value the better. Objects can be masked or hidden behind bright blooms of light in tubes that have higher halo values. Lasers can also have more apparent bloom off certain objects in some tubes as opposed to others due to this attribute. A high halo value can contribute to a lowering of tube resolution (high light res) thus affecting what can be seen/detected by the user.

nods bloom

Above: Halo comes into play when looking at a light source that has the potential to overload receptors in your NV tubes. High-quality tubes will be able to better modulate incoming light from secondary sources like lights and illuminators.

FOM or Figure of Merit: This is simply center resolution multiplied by signal to noise ratio. The higher the value the better. It’s a quick, down-and-dirty way to determine the performance of a tube, mostly for export purposes set forth by the U.S. State Department. Because FOM measures only two data points, it’s not the be-all and end-all of a tube’s performance. In other words, you could have a low to average FOM tube that can, in certain lighting conditions, outperform a tube with a higher FOM, or at least match its real-world performance. EBI, photocathode sensitivity, and halo are three very important data points to take note of when looking at a tube. 

Are Tube Specs Important?

This is an often-asked question and the short answer is maybe, maybe not. If you’re using a NODs as a stand-alone unit without supplemental infrared (IR) laser/light energy, such as for astronomy purposes, then a tube with high data points overall is going to do more for you than a lower performing system. Notice I didn’t say FOM — as I stated previously, FOM is not the be-all and end-all in a system, though it should be noted. 

Now, can a human tell the difference between a 30 SNR tube and a 37 SNR tube? Not in all but the darkest of lighting conditions. Even then maybe not, depending on the viewer’s eyesight. You can chase NODs tube specs until you’re blue in the face, and in reality gain nothing but wasted time and energy. Go with what I list below as a template for tube specs, and try not to get too wrapped around the axle about them.

For a thin-filmed Gen 3 system some good numbers to go off of as of the writing of this paper would be as follows:

  • Photocathode: 1,900 or higher
  • EBI: 1.5 or lower
  • SNR: 26.0 or higher
  • Center Resolution: 64 LP/mm
  • Halo: 1.0 or lower
  • FOM: 1728 or higher

Moving onto an unfilmed system, good numbers to go off of are as follows:

  • Photocathode: 2,000 or higher
  • EBI: 1.0 or lower
  • SNR: 30.0 or higher
  • Center Resolution: 64 LP/mm 
  • Halo: 0.8 or lower
  • FOM: 1920 or higher

If you have NODs that exhibits most or all of these numbers, you possess a very solid performing system.

Green Phosphor Nods image

If you’re using supplemental IR lighting in conjunction with NODs for detection and targeting, then that’s going to boost the capability of a lower performing system significantly to the point where tube specs are going to matter less and less. This is especially true at close ranges under 100 meters. Put simply, a powerful laser/illuminator is going to do more for you than tube specs will almost every time. 

Ultimately though, it comes down to training with your gear and training your eyes how to observe your environment. As you spend more time using NODs and acclimating your eyes to them, you’ll be able to see things with a lower performance system than folks who are untrained and unaccustomed to using a higher performance system. If I was behind the wheel of a high-performance Formula 1 car, a skilled racecar driver could still beat me around a track in a street car simply because I don’t have the experience to make the most of that highly tuned vehicle.

Affordable Versatility

Sionyx uses digital night vision technology — as opposed to the analog tubes used by most of its competitors — to give you a view of the midnight realm in full-blown technicolor. After spending years staring at varying shades of green or gray, I was eager to get my hands on a system that could revolutionize how we interact with the dark.

Sionyx on MK18

Above: When the Trijicon MRO and Sionyx Pro are properly aligned, nighttime range training becomes a walk in the park.

If you’ve ever looked at what it costs for a third-generation night vision optic or a FLIR thermal optic, you’ll quickly learn that it’s not an inexpensive purchase. For thousands of dollars, you can have the latest analog, monochromatic optic. Now look at the top model that Sionyx has to offer, just south of a grand. They even offer financing for those of us who don’t have fat stacks of Benjamins lying around. Models with fewer features are even less expensive, making Sionyx a widely accessible option for those who need to see in the dark.

Options. As if Seeing in the Dark Wasn’t Enough …

There are several models to choose from (Aurora Sport, Aurora Black, Aurora, and Aurora Pro) each with their own pros and cons. Every optic is water- and dust-resistant, and submersible down to 3 feet for 30 minutes, which means any Sionyx optic is safe to use in the most torrential downpours. A clear, scratch-resistant lens cover keeps your view crystal-clear without having to worry too much about abrasions, and each model has been drop tested from 1 meter onto concrete. Durability in harsh conditions is great, but how do these digital optics differ from their analog counterparts? 

All models have built-in memory, because they not only allow you to see in color in the dark, they also double as a digital camera which has settings comparable to a DSLR, including the ability to adjust your aperture and shutter speed. An accelerometer will let you take panoramic pictures in landscape or portrait modes. Sionyx optics will also film video at 720p with an adjustable frame rate of up to 60 frames per second. Remove the micro OLED 1024×768 eyepiece, and you’ll be able to increase the storage capacity with your choice of MicroSD card. I recommend choosing a high-quality MicroSD with fast transfer rates. 

In addition to these standard features, the Black, Aurora, and Pro models offer additional benefits. They are weapons-rated up to .223/5.56, and both the Aurora and the Pro feature GPS, compass, metadata, and accelerometer recording. The Pro tops out the memory features with 256 gigabytes of onboard memory, and a 32-gigabyte MicroSD card. Sionyx also offers an attachable IR light that enhances visibility through the optic, as well as a Picatinny rail adapter that allows you to mount the optic to your favorite weapon. 

Sionyx Aurora GalilAbove: Jeff Stroud (aka Freebird) eagerly prepares to engage targets previously obscured by the dark.

The applications for a night vision optic dramatically increase when it’s paired with the right mounting options. With the use of a Wilcox helmet mount, rail adapter, and your choice of tactical head gear, you can walk around with this optic hands-free. Ram Mounts makes ruggedized device cradles, and with the right one, you can attach the optic to the handlebar or storage rack of an ATV or snowmobile.

What are some commonly held myths about Night Vision?

DJ: Let’s be honest, Night Vision feels like a superpower. At the same time, you can defeat Night Vision with a $2 flashlight. We’ve seen it time and time again. The person wearing NODs has to be very good at going from looking through the tubes, to looking underneath and around them.

There’s little things: It’s easy for night vision to give you a false sense of security: You’re not a demi-god, and you’re not invisible.

When have you seen Night Vision become a Hindrance?

GBRS Group: When someone does not understand the true light-ing conditions around themselves. They’ll think that they are in the dark, but they are not. If the ambient light is just a few degrees brighter than inside a building, someone standing outside is going to be backlit. Their silhouette is going to show.

What’s the difference between single tube, dual tube, and 4 tube Night Vision?

GBRS Group: The field of view changes everything. Single tube night vision isn’t part of the conversation because of the total lack of situational awareness. Typical dual tubes have 40 degrees, where 4-tube night vision has  97 degrees. That means less tunnel vision. When you’re looking through night vision, if an object is even slightly outside of that field of view, you don’t see it at all. Adding that extra field of view increases both reaction time, and situational awareness. It gets really dangerous when do- ing things like breaching or skydiving, or riding a dirt bike under night vision.

What different types of environments have you used night vision and how do they affect the gear?

GBRS Group: Pretty much every environment: diving underwater with the tubes on, navigating, to jumping from a plane, to beaches, to desert. The temperature shifts are a nightmare. Jumping from 25k feet, to landing, that condensation build-up is ter- rible. In cold weather conditions, when you enter a building, the condensation is going to build instantaneously and fog up the tubes. If you don’t know that, you’re going to walk into that room blind. Rain, sleet and snow make visibility terrible as well.

If there’s condensation on Night Vision, and you walk into a dust cloud, it can quickly turn into mud. Most operators carry a specific rag just for cleaning and wiping their tubes.

What are things that you can do with night vision that you cannot do with Thermals?

GBRS Group: With Night Vision you can tell the emotion of who you’re looking at and read facial features. Since night vision is the amplification of ambient light, it can be defeated by good camouflage.

On the other side, you can see really well through a Woodline with thermals. Unless someone is wearing special materials, they’re going to give off that heat signature. What it doesn’t offer is details, which are much more important when up close and attempting PID.

Where most equipment is at now, smoke and glass can sometimes defeat thermals, but we wouldn’t be surprised if that changes soon.
